What is Desmopressin Acetate?

Desmopressin Acetate is a synthetic hormone used to manage conditions like diabetes insipidus and nocturnal enuresis. This oral medication helps regulate fluid balance in the body.

What is Desmopressin Acetate used for?

Desmopressin Acetate is primarily used to treat diabetes insipidus, a condition characterized by excessive thirst and urination. It is also commonly prescribed for nocturnal enuresis, or bedwetting, in children. The medication works by reducing the amount of urine produced by the kidneys. People often ask, 'What is Desmopressin Acetate used for?' It is also used in certain bleeding disorders to help control bleeding.

What are the side effects of Desmopressin Acetate?

Common effects of Desmopressin Acetate may include headache, nausea, and flushing. Some users might experience dizziness or stomach upset. These effects are generally mild and temporary, but if they persist or worsen, it is important to consult a healthcare provider.

What precautions apply to Desmopressin Acetate?

Desmopressin Acetate should be used with caution in individuals with certain medical conditions, such as heart disease or kidney problems. It is important to follow the prescribed dosage and administration instructions provided by a healthcare professional. Always store the medication as directed to maintain its effectiveness.

What does Desmopressin Acetate interact with?

Desmopressin Acetate may interact with certain medications, including n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) and some antidepressants. It is important to inform your healthcare provider about all med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ions. Alcohol consumption should also be discussed with a healthcare provider, as it may affect the medication's efficacy.
